Web11 Sep 2024 · What does not upheld mean in law? An appeal may be upheld if the findings show that the service provided by the police did not reach the standard a reasonable person could expect. If an appeal is not upheld, it may mean that the service the police provided was of a standard that a reasonable person could expect. It means the appeal wins the argument. In a disciplinary event, where the original finding was argued (appealed), the appeal won. “Uphold” means “support.”. If a decision is apppealed, the appellate court upholds either the appeal, or the original decision.

Web18 Jul 2024 · The grievance is partially upheld; The grievance is not upheld; Each outcome will constitute different action depending on the nature of the grievance. For example, if an employee has raised a grievance regarding bullying against a colleague, the employer has subsequently investigated and upheld the grievance; the next steps may be to commence ... WebIf your grievance is partially or not upheld, you have the right to appeal the decision. Appealing the Outcome of a Grievance If you are not satisfied with the outcome of your grievance you can appeal the decision.
